1

情况描述

在现有开发过程中更改了代码中的引脚号,并使用 MCC 进行了更改。

更改后设备不工作。

如下图所示,根据Micro Chip的描述,现有开发代码中使用MCC时没有生成main.c。在我的代码中,所有代码都再次生成。

我使用了第三方板,没有用于调试的端口。

在此处输入图像描述

我的电脑设置

操作系统:Ubuntu 18.04 LTS

IDE:MPLAB X IDE v5.30

插件:MPLAB@ 代码配置器 3.x

挖掘机工具:PICKIT 3

问题

我有两个问题。

  1. 是否有一个选项来检查该选项是否是现有的开发代码?找的时候没找到。

  2. 现有的IDE是5.25,但是开发IDE已经升级到5.30了。有区别吗?

资源

MPLAB® 代码配置器 (MCC):https ://microchipdeveloper.com/mplabx:mcc

PICkit™ 3 在线调试器:https ://www.microchip.com/Developmenttools/ProductDetails/PG164130

dsPIC33EV 5V CAN-LIN 入门工具包:https ://www.microchip.com/DevelopmentTools/ProductDetails/dm330018

4

1 回答 1

0

当使用 MCC 更改代码时,会新建 main.c 文件并将 main.c 添加到 Configurations.c 文件中。

如果您删除 main.c ,它会起作用。

在此处输入图像描述

于 2019-12-22T23:52:32.827 回答